Course Information

  • Assessment NA

Venue

Kuala Lumpur: G-3A-02, Suite Pejabat Korporat, KL Gateway, No 2, Jalan kerinchi, Gerbang kernichi Lestari, 59200 Kuala Lumpur, Malaysia
Penang: Jalan Sungai Dua, 11700 Penang, Malaysia.

Download Course Brochure

Certification

  • Certificate of Completion from Tertiary Courses - Upon meeting at least 75% attendance and passing the assessment(s), participants will receive a Certificate of Completion from Tertiary Courses.

CertPREP Courseware: HTML5 Application Development (INF-306) - Self-Paced

Course Code: E030
  • HRDF

What's This Course About

CertPREP HTML5 Application Development (INF-306) is a self-paced course designed to equip learners with the practical skills needed to build responsive, interactive web applications. Starting with application lifecycle management and debugging techniques, learners progress into creating stunning visuals using HTML5 <canvas> and <svg>, applying CSS effects, and integrating animations and styled graphics.

The course also covers building validated HTML forms, mastering responsive layouts using CSS Flexbox and Grid, and JavaScript essentials such as working with classes, handling events, accessing data, and using APIs. Learners will gain confidence in managing stateful web applications, making this course ideal for aspiring front-end developers and designers aiming to build engaging, standards-compliant web experiences.

Description

This self-paced CertPREP IT Specialist HTML5 Application Development (INF-306) Course is designed to prepare students to develop dynamic web applications for different devices. HTML is commonly thought to be used as a web technology to get a user interface. However, this course will focus on HTML5, CSS, and JavaScript in application development. Upon completion of this course, the students will be able to evaluate, design, and develop functional and responsive web applications that will run on a variety of devices, such as PCs, tablets, and phones.

Course components:

  • Lessons
  • Video learning
  • MeasureUp Practice Test for IT Specialist HTML5 Application Development. Practice Mode with remediation and Certification mode to simulate the test day experience.

Duration: Approximately 24 hours of primary content. Each learner will progress at their own rate.

Audience:

This course has been designed for high school students and intermediate-level developers who are interested in taking the next step in application development and in obtaining a working-level proficiency with HTML5 and CSS. After taking this course, you will be able to write syntactically correct HTML5 and CSS and utilize JavaScript to create an interactive web experience. You will also be able to employ the canvas element, the svg element, and CSS to achieve professional styling and manage content layout. Another important outcome from this course is the ability to develop applications that are responsive on various devices.

Prerequisites:

  • The students should have some basic knowledge of operating systems and computer networks.
  • The students should be familiar with the usage of the Internet and web browsers.

Course Fee

MYR660.00

Additional Note

Disclaimer: The course dates displayed on our website are tentative and subject to trainer availability. We will confirm the final date after checking with the trainer. You are also welcome to email us your preferred date at sales@tertiarycourses.com.my, and we will do our best to coordinate with the trainer's schedule.

Post-Course Support

  • We may provide consultation related to the subject matter after the course.
  • Please email your queries to sales@tertiarycourses.com.my and we will forward your queries to the subject matter experts and get back to you as soon as possible.

Cancellation & Reschedule Policy

  • We reserve the right to cancel or re-schedule the course due to unforeseen circumstances. If the course is cancelled, we will refund 100% to participants.
  • Note: the venue of the training is subject to changes due to class size and availability of the classroom. The minimum class size to start a class is 3 Pax.

Course Details

Course Details

What You'll Learn

Lesson 1: Application Lifecycle Management

  • Skill 1.1: Describe the application lifecycle management stages
  • Skill 1.2: Debug and test web apps

Lesson 2: Graphics and Animation

  • Skill 2.1: Use the canvas element to create graphics and animations
  • Skill 2.2: Use the svg element to create and display graphics
  • Skill 2.3: Transform, style, and enhance text and graphics
  • Skill 2.4: Apply CSS filters to images

Lesson 3: Forms

  • Skill 3.1: Construct and analyze markup that uses form elements
  • Skill 3.2: Configure input validation

Lesson 4: Layouts

  • Skill 4.1: Manage content layout, positioning, and flow by using CSS
  • Skill 4.2: Construct layouts by using responsive design
  • Skill 4.3: Construct flexible responsive layouts by using CSS flexbox
  • Skill 4.4: Construct grid-based layouts by using CSS grid

Lesson 5: JavaScript Coding

  • Skill 5.1: Create and use custom classes
  • Skill 5.2: Perform data access by using JavaScript
  • Skill 5.3: Construct code that responds to events by using event listeners and handlers
  • Skill 5.4: Construct code that uses JavaScript APIs
  • Skill 5.5: Manage the state of an application

Job Roles

Job Roles

  • Front-End Web Developer
  • HTML5/CSS3 Developer
  • UI/UX Developer
  • JavaScript Front-End Developer
  • Web Application Designer
  • Junior Software Engineer (Front-End)
  • Responsive Web Designer
  • Web Animation Specialist
  • HTML/CSS Layout Developer
  • Web App Tester
  • JavaScript Event Handler Developer
  • Interactive Web Designer
  • Form Validation Developer
  • DOM Manipulation Assistant
  • Front-End QA Intern
  • Canvas & SVG Integration Specialist
  • Mobile Web Developer
  • JavaScript API Integrator
  • Entry-Level Full Stack Developer (Front-End Focus)
  • Web Application Support Assistant

Review

Write Your Own Review

You're reviewing: CertPREP Courseware: HTML5 Application Development (INF-306) - Self-Paced

How do you rate this product? *

  1 star 2 stars 3 stars 4 stars 5 stars
1. Do you find the course meet your expectation?
2. Do you find the trainer knowledgeable in this subject?
3. How do you find the training environment